Anti-Rift Valley fever virus monoclonal antibodies (also known as the Anti-RVFV two-mAb combination) is a biologic drug candidate being developed by IDBiologics as a medical countermeasure against Rift Valley fever virus (RVFV). The product consists of a combination of two human monoclonal antibodies, including candidates RVFV-268 and RVFV-379, which were originally identified by researchers at Vanderbilt University. These antibodies are designed to neutralize RVFV by binding to the viral surface glycoproteins Gn and Gc, thereby preventing viral entry into host cells. The drug is intended for both the treatment and prevention (prophylaxis) of Rift Valley fever, an arthropod-borne disease that poses a significant epidemic risk in Africa and is considered a potential biothreat agent. IDBiologics is advancing this program under a contract with the United States Department of Defense (DOD).
